🗂️ Glossary

Esoteric

Relating to or accessible only by a select group of people with a specialized knowledge or interest; inner teachings as opposed to exoteric (outward).

Hermeticism

A religious, philosophical, and esoteric tradition based primarily upon writings attributed to Hermes Trismegistus. It emphasizes spiritual alchemy and the interconnectedness of all things.

Kabbalah

A system of Jewish mysticism that explores the divine nature and the creation of the universe through symbolic interpretation of scripture and mystical diagrams like the Tree of Life.

Neoplatonism

A philosophical system that developed from Plato's teachings, emphasizing the existence of a supreme, transcendent 'One' from which all reality emanates.

Allegory

A story, poem, or picture that can be interpreted to reveal a hidden meaning, typically a moral or political one, using symbolic figures and actions.
